What is the scope of the federal government's authority in the regulation of pharmaceuticals?

The federal government has a wide array of legal authorities when it comes to regulating pharmaceuticals. The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act (FDCA) is the primary law that gives the federal government authority to regulate drugs and other products that touch the human body. The FDCA gives the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) the power to review the safety and effectiveness of drugs, inspect manufacturing facilities, and set standards for drug labeling. The FDCA also provides the FDA with the authority to approve drug advertising, as well as set requirements for the protection of confidential information related to confidential clinical drug trials. The Controlled Substances Act of 1970 is another important law related to drug regulation. The act sets out regulations for drugs with addictive potential, such as prescription drugs and illicit drugs. The act also requires the registration of drug manufacturers, dealers, and distributors, and provides for criminal penalties for violations of the act. The FDCA also has a number of regulations related to the drug supply chain, including the requirement for drug manufacturers to maintain records of all transactions and the requirement for drug wholesalers to report suspicious orders to the FDA. Additionally, the FDCA provides for the establishment of drug safety monitoring systems that can detect and investigate potential adverse drug events. In California, the state Department of Public Health has additional regulations related to pharmaceuticals. These regulations may include additional requirements related to storage, distribution, and labeling, and may also cover the registration and inspection of drug manufacturers and suppliers.
